New York, NY - January 9th, 2026 - UBS has upgraded Waste Connections (NYSE: WCN) from Neutral to Buy, signaling a potential turning point for the landfill management and waste services company. The move comes as Waste Connections has underperformed compared to its peers over the past year, but analysts at UBS believe the stock is now primed for a significant rebound, offering a favorable risk-reward profile for investors.
The upgrade, announced today, includes a raised price target of $195 per share. This represents a substantial 22% increase from the stock's most recent closing price, suggesting significant upside potential according to UBS's projections.
Analyst Caleb Dorfman, in a research note to clients, highlighted the firm's confidence in Waste Connections' fundamental strengths. "We are upgrading Waste Connections to Buy from Neutral as we believe the risk/reward is becoming more favorable," Dorfman stated. He further emphasized the company's consistent operational execution and robust free cash flow generation as key drivers behind the positive outlook.
Sector Tailwinds Support Growth Expectations
The timing of the upgrade aligns with broader positive trends within the waste management sector. UBS points to several 'secular tailwinds' that are expected to bolster the industry's growth. These include increasingly stringent environmental regulations, which necessitate advanced waste disposal and recycling technologies, and the continued rise in population density, driving higher volumes of waste generation.
Waste Connections, in particular, is well-positioned to capitalize on these trends. The company operates a geographically diverse network of landfills, transfer stations, and collection services, catering to both residential and commercial customers. Its focus on resource recovery and sustainable waste management practices positions it favorably as environmental consciousness grows among consumers and regulators.
Premium Valuation Justified by Performance
While Waste Connections currently trades at a premium valuation compared to some of its competitors, UBS argues that this is warranted given the company's superior growth rate and profitability. The firm anticipates that Waste Connections will continue to benefit from a combination of increased waste volumes and the ability to implement strategic price increases, maintaining healthy margins even amidst potential inflationary pressures.
"Waste Connections consistently demonstrates a strong ability to manage costs and drive efficiency," noted Dorfman. "This allows them to maintain profitability even while investing in new technologies and expanding their service offerings."

Potential Risks to Consider
While UBS's outlook is decidedly optimistic, it's important to acknowledge potential risks. Changes in economic conditions could impact waste generation rates, particularly from the commercial and industrial sectors. Increased competition from smaller, regional waste management companies could also put pressure on pricing. Finally, unforeseen regulatory changes or environmental liabilities could pose a challenge to the company's profitability.
Despite these risks, UBS believes that the potential rewards outweigh the downsides, making Waste Connections an attractive investment opportunity at current levels. The firm's upgrade serves as a clear signal to the market that it anticipates a resurgence in the company's stock performance.
